Knut Hamsun is Norway's most famous and admired author. Ever since he was young he has hated the English for the starvation they caused Norway during WWI. When the Germans occupy Norway 9 April 1940 he welcomes them and the protection they can give from Great Britain. He supports the national socialist ideals, but opposes the way these ideals are turned into action - that Norwegians are jailed and executed. His wife Marie travels in Germany during the war as a sign of support from Knut and herself.

The runtime is 159 minutes (2h 39m).
The film features dialogue in 5 languages: Danish, German, Norwegian, Swedish, English.
It was a co-production between: Denmark, Germany, Norway, Sweden.
The film was directed by Jan Troell.
The screenplay was written by Jan Troell and Per Olov Enquist.
Cinematography was handled by Mischa Gavrjusjov.
